The Grady County Commissioners have extend the county-wide burn ban with provisions for farmers and ranchers to perform prescribed burns. Those who need to perform a prescribed burn must follow the guidelines set by the the Oklahoma Forestry Services and Oklahoma State Statute. Please see the requirements here.

Aug. 29—The Grady County Commissioners have extended the county-wide burn ban for one more week. Currently, Grady County is in the extreme drought category, along with several surrounding counties, according to the Oklahoma Mesonet Drought Monitor. Some counties have stepped down to the severe category, likely due to recent rainfall. Similarly, there are less than 20 Oklahoma counties under ...

The OKCFD Fire Code Compliance team wants you to have all of the ...What is the County Commissioners Notification Process? Notice of a burn ban resolution shall be submitted to: Forestry Division of the Oklahoma Department of Agriculture, Food, and Forestry via email at [email protected] . Faxed copies will not be accepted. Resolutions received by 4:00 PM will be posted on the Oklahoma Forestry Services ...Sep 21, 2022 Updated Sep 21, 2022.
